After becoming a shareholder of Koenigsegg, a Sweden sports car manufacturer, which is the parent company of SAAB. The cooperation between SAAB and Beijing Automotive Group is going to a substantive level.
According to the insider of Beijing automotive group, who told the reporter of National Business Daily, The localization of SAAB is taking into consideration by BAIC (Beijing Automotive Group), but the final result is depending upon the negotiations between the 2 parties. And it was indicated by Jan-Åke Jonsson Managing Director of SAAB,who claimed that the distributors of SAAB in china will increased from 15 to 30, and in the future, the manufacturing department will located in china. But he emphasized that up till present moment, there is no definite answer.
At present, SAAB sells its cars in china through the marketing network of SGM (Shanghai General Motors) as imported ones. As for shanghai motors, the partner of SAAB in shanghai, Johnson said clearly, merely as a temporary agreement with SGM, the cooperation between shanghai motors and SAAB will be ceased gradually.
Obviously in the future, SAAB will depend on BAIC after ceasing the cooperation with SGM and SM. As for the new strategic move in Chinese market, Wang Dazong, general manager of BAIC, revealed to the media the ally between Renault and Nissan have set up a good example for BAIC, they will open up and develop Chinese market with SAAB together, and also assist SAAB to strengthen their distributing network in china, as for how to supply their products to the expanding scale of distributors, Wang did not gave the specific details.
